Ingredients
Scale
- 1 cup unsalted butter (2 sticks)
- 1 cup pumpkin puree (100% pure)
- 1 cup brown sugar (light or dark)
- ½ cup granulated sugar
- 2 ½ cups all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p baking soda
- 1 tsp ground cinnamon
- 1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ips
Instructions
- Brown the butter in a saucepan over medium heat until golden brown and nutty.
- In a large bowl, whisk together the browned butter, pumpkin puree,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until creamy.
- In another bowl, mix the flour, baking soda, and cinnamon.
- Gradually add the dry mixture to the wet mixture until just combined; do not overmix.
- Fold in chocolate chips gently.
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and line baking sheets with parchment paper.
-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to prepared sheets and bake for 10-12 minutes until edges are slightly crisp.
